Statement of Need: The morbidity and mortality of cancer is still a public health crisis. Pancreatic cancer, in particular, has one of the worst survival rates. Increased knowledge of new treatment methodologies, new research being done in the disease and how to best care for the patient with Pancreas cancer are vitally important to improving the survival rate of patients with pancreatic cancer. Each year more and more research is being done in pancreatic cancer requiring physicians and advanced clinical providers to have knowledge of new medications used to treat the disease. New to cancer diagnosis and treatment is the use of molecular biology and genetic testing. It has been found that different molecular abnormalities of pancreatic cancer react differently to different medications to treat pancreatic cancer. Providing our learners with the extensive knowledge of molecular and genetic testing in correlation to the appropriate therapy to treat a pancreatic patient is of utmost importance. This conference will provide the opportunity for participants to increase their knowledge and competencies in the care and management of pancreatic cancer


Target Audience: This activity was planned by and for MDs, and PAs. All other members of the healthcare team who are interested in the field of Pancreatic Cancer, NPs, RNs, Residents, Fellows, Medical Students, and Northwell Retirees are invited to attend.

Program Objectives: All Northwell Health CME activities are intended to improve patient care, safety, and outcomes. At the conclusion of this conference participants should be able to:

– Review and analyze advances in the treatment of pancreatic cancer including newly available clinical trials...

– Identify specific clinical trials available to pancreatic cancer patients at different stages of the disease process.

– Describe specific mutations found in patients with pancreatic cancer that would indicate use of a specific Medic*tion to treat the disease
